Contract with Alstom to supply locomotives to Ukrzaliznytsia to be signed by year end – Kubrakov

KYIV. Nov 9 (Interfax-Ukraine) – A contract with the French concern Alstom for the supply of 130 electric locomotives to Ukrzaliznytsia will be signed by the end of this year, Minister of Infrastructure of Ukraine Oleksandr Kubrakov believes.

"We already have a government resolution, an intergovernmental agreement has been signed. We are moving towards signing a real contract. I am sure it will be signed by the end of this year," the minister said during the Big Construction: New Ukrzaliznytsia forum.

As Kubrakov noted, the French side is meeting halfway and "moving towards localization."

Earlier, Alstom announced its readiness to sign commercial agreements for the supply of 130 electric locomotives to Ukrzaliznytsia in October 2021.

As reported, Ukraine and France in May signed a framework intergovernmental agreement on financing the supply by Alstom of 130 heavy-duty electric locomotives for Ukrzaliznytsia worth up to EUR 900 million. The document was ratified by the Verkhovna Rada on July 1, 2021.

Alstom is one of the world leaders (along with Siemens and Bombardier) in the production of power equipment and rail transport. It operates in more than 70 countries and employs about 70,000 people.
